Haiti - Politic : Creation of the Solidarity Fund for the reconstruction of the National Palace

The Government has published in the official newspaper "Le Moniteur" dated March 7, 2018, the decree establishing the Solidarity Fund for the reconstruction of the historic building of the National Palace. This decree establishes transparent mechanisms to receive voluntary contributions from individuals and institutions as part of the reconstruction of the National Palace.

This Solidarity Fund is made up of:

1.- Voluntary contributions in cash and in kind of citizens of Haiti and the diaspora as well as foreign nationals;

2. Donations and legacies of public and private institutions, both national and foreign, including interest-free loans;

3.- Contributions to work, including individual volunteering, the provision, free of charge, of resource persons, technicians, workers by public or private entities;

4.- Free contributions in food and drinking water;

5.- Contributions in goods and services, including the provision, free of charge, of heavy equipment, premises, materials and equipment, means of transport and intellectual services.

In addition, it should be noted that cash contributions will be paid against receipt, either to the BRH or to the Ministry of Economy and Finance, at the headquarters of the Project Coordination Unit (UCP) hich manages the Fund domiciled with the BRH.

On the other hand, contributions in kind will be monetized by the Monetary Office of Development Assistance Programs (BMPAD).

The money resulting from this monetization operation will be fully transferred to the account of the Solidarity Fund for the Reconstruction of the National Palace.
